Chichi is a Rural village located in Katamdag, Hazaribagh, Jharkhand.

The total population of Chichi is 416.

Chichi village comprises 77 households.

The literacy rate in Chichi is 63.8%. Among the literate population of 219, there are 133 literate males and 86 literate females.

In Chichi, there are 204 males and 212 females, with a sex ratio of 1039 females per 1000 males.

There are 73 children (17.5% of population), comprising 38 boys and 35 girls.

The total number of workers in Chichi is 178, with 38 main workers and 140 marginal workers.

In Chichi, there are 398 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(194 males, 204 females) and 0 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(0 males, 0 females).

Chichi is located in Jharkhand state, Hazaribagh district, and falls under Katamdag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 368682 and LGD code is 368682.
